WebGeneral UK premature birth statistics. Around 8% of births in the UK are preterm. That is around 60,000 babies each year. This is higher than many countries in Europe and higher than Cuba and Iran; Of the births that were preterm in the UK: 5% were extremely preterm (before 28 weeks) 11% were very preterm (between 28 and 32 weeks)

WebNov 14, 2024 · Preterm is defined as babies born alive before 37 weeks of pregnancy are completed. There are sub-categories of preterm birth, based on gestational age: extremely preterm (less than 28 weeks) very preterm (28 to 32 weeks) moderate to late preterm (32 to 37 weeks).
